    Earning Potential

    Today’s career/tech education programs are just the first step to lucrative careers.  With such high demands for skilled work force students are finding beginning wages in the workplace that range from $14-$35 per hour directly after completion of high school.  Many students are going directly into the industry and earning tuituion reembursement from their union or company.   

    CTE preparation leads to professions that are:

    • High-skill
    • High-wage
    • High-demand
